The Ultralight Philosophy and Stove Weight Thresholds

The ultralight movement has matured beyond simply counting grams to understanding the cascading effects of every gear choice. When your stove weighs less than three ounces, you’re not just saving weight—you’re enabling different trip styles, reducing pack volume, and minimizing the physical and mental load of wilderness travel. This weight threshold represents a psychological barrier where the stove becomes essentially weightless in your pack, yet its impact on your daily routine remains profound.

Base Weight Implications

Dropping your stove into the sub-3oz category can shift your entire cook system under 8 ounces total when paired with a titanium pot and DIY windscreen. This matters because once your base weight dips below 10 pounds, each additional ounce feels exponentially more significant. The stove becomes a fulcrum point where you either maintain that sublime ultralight freedom or tip back into conventional backpacking weight ranges.

Fuel Type Considerations for Sub-3oz Stoves

Your fuel choice dictates stove design more than any other factor, and each option carries hidden weight penalties beyond the stove itself. The complete system weight—including fuel container, required accessories, and typical fuel consumption—often tells a different story than the stove’s standalone spec.

System Weight vs. Stove Weight

A 2.5-ounce alcohol stove might require a 1.2-ounce fuel bottle and 0.3-ounce measuring cup, while a 2.8-ounce canister stove needs a partially-filled canister that weighs significantly more. The minimalist evaluates total system weight for their specific trip duration and resupply points, not just the stove in isolation.

Canister stoves dominate the sub-3oz category through elegant simplicity: a threaded titanium valve body with minimal pot supports. Their advantage lies in convenience—twist-on, light, and adjust—but this simplicity masks important considerations for the discerning minimalist.

Pressure Regulation Realities

In 2026, most ultralight canister stoves lack pressure regulation to save weight, meaning performance drops noticeably as temperatures fall below 40°F or as canisters deplete. The minimalist must decide whether carrying a slightly heavier regulated model outweighs the skill required to manage these limitations through techniques like canister warming or inverted operation.

Alcohol Stoves: The DIY Minimalist’s Dream

No other stove category embodies ultralight philosophy like the alcohol stove. Weighing as little as 0.4 ounces for a simple titanium caldera design, these stoves represent the ultimate in field-maintainable, fuel-flexible cooking systems. The learning curve, however, is steeper than any other option.

Fuel Efficiency and Boil Times

Alcohol stoves typically require 0.5-0.75 ounces of fuel per pint boiled under ideal conditions, meaning a weekend trip needs just 2-3 ounces of fuel. But wind sensitivity and lack of flame adjustment demand practiced technique. The 2026 minimalist views this not as a drawback but as a skill that deepens their connection to the cooking process.

Solid Fuel Tablets: The Ultimate Simplicity

Esbit-style tablets and their modern alternatives represent the absolute minimum viable cooking system. The stoves themselves are often simple titanium folding platforms weighing under 0.5 ounces, but the fuel leaves a sticky residue and distinctive odor that many find objectionable.

Residue Management Strategies

Minimalists who commit to solid fuel develop rituals: dedicated pot bottoms that never touch food, specific storage bags that contain the chemical smell, and precise timing to burn tablets completely. The weight savings become worthwhile only when these practices become second nature.

Wood-Burning Micro Stoves: The Fuel-Free Frontier

The most radical minimalists in 2026 are embracing wood-burning stoves that weigh under 2.5 ounces, effectively eliminating carried fuel weight on trips through forested terrain. These gasifier designs create surprising efficiency through secondary combustion, but they demand constant attention and produce smoke.

Fire Restriction Navigation

The Achilles heel of wood stoves remains fire bans. Savvy minimalists carry a backup alcohol burner that nests inside the wood stove, creating a hybrid system that adapts to regulations while maintaining the same pot interface and windscreen configuration.

BTU Output and Boil Time Realities

A stove’s BTU rating becomes almost irrelevant in the sub-3oz category because pot design and wind protection influence real-world performance more than raw heat output. Most ultralight stoves produce 7,000-10,000 BTU, yet boil times vary from 3.5 to 8 minutes for a pint of water based entirely on system integration.

The Efficiency Paradox

Paradoxically, the most powerful ultralight stoves often prove less efficient in the field. A roaring flame that extends beyond your pot’s diameter wastes heat to the atmosphere, while a smaller, more focused flame can achieve faster boil times with less fuel. The minimalist prioritizes the latter, accepting slightly longer boils for significant fuel savings over a week-long trip.

Stability and Safety in Featherweight Designs

When your entire stove system weighs less than a smartphone, stability becomes a user-skill issue rather than an engineering problem. Three-prong pot supports are standard, but their footprint rarely exceeds 3.5 inches, demanding careful site selection and level ground.

Center of Gravity Management

The minimalist learns to position fuel canisters or bottles as ballast, aligning them with the pot’s center of gravity. Some 2026 designs incorporate subtle features like serrated pot support tips that bite into titanium pot handles, creating a more integrated system that resists tipping through friction rather than mass.

Ignition Systems: Built-in vs Carry-Your-Own

Built-in piezo igniters typically add 0.3-0.5 ounces and represent the most common failure point in ultralight stoves. The committed minimalist carries a 0.1-ounce mini Bic lighter or ferrocerium rod, accepting the minor inconvenience for reliability and weight savings.

Redundancy Philosophy

The ultralight approach to ignition involves two tiny, independent systems rather than one integrated but vulnerable component. A mini Bic plus a ferro rod weigh less than a piezo igniter and provide true redundancy, embodying the minimalist principle of simple, replaceable parts.

Cold Weather Performance Considerations

Sub-3oz stoves reveal their limitations most starkly in cold conditions. Canister stoves struggle with vapor pressure, alcohol stoves face sluggish fuel vaporization, and wood stoves contend with wet fuel. The 2026 minimalist plans for these challenges rather than avoiding them.

Winter Workarounds

Techniques like sleeping with your fuel canister, using a dedicated insulated canister cozy, or priming alcohol stoves with a few drops of fuel on the primer pan become essential skills. These methods add zero weight but require knowledge and practice that separate the casual user from the committed minimalist.

Wind Resistance Without Added Weight

Commercial windscreens often weigh as much as the stoves they protect, defeating the purpose. The minimalist solution involves site selection, natural barriers, and DIY windscreens from repurposed materials like aluminum flashing or even carefully positioned rocks.

Integrated Windscreen Designs

Some 2026 stove designs incorporate the windscreen into the pot support structure itself, using perforated titanium that both supports your pot and blocks wind. This integration adds mere grams while dramatically improving efficiency, representing the evolution of holistic system design.

Durability vs. Ultralight Trade-offs

A sub-3oz stove will never be as durable as its 8-ounce cousin, but durability becomes a relative concept. These stoves are designed to be used, not abused, and their lifespan depends entirely on user technique and maintenance discipline.

Expected Lifespan Realities

With proper care, a titanium ultralight stove should last 500+ cooking cycles. The failure points are almost always user-induced: cross-threading the canister connection, stepping on the stove, or packing it with abrasive grit. The minimalist treats their stove as precision equipment, not camp furniture.

Integration with Cook Systems

The stove doesn’t exist in isolation—its value depends entirely on how well it integrates with your pot, windscreen, and fuel storage. The most elegant 2026 systems nest together in a package smaller than a water bottle, with each component designed to work synergistically.

Pot Interface Optimization

Flat-bottomed, wide pots (750ml-900ml) maximize stability and heat transfer with minimal stoves. The minimalist chooses pots with integrated heat exchangers only when the weight penalty (typically 0.5-1 ounce) is offset by fuel savings on longer trips without resupply.

Price-to-Weight Ratio Economics

Sub-3oz stoves range from $15 DIY alcohol setups to $150+ specialized canister models. The cost per ounce saved follows a brutal exponential curve, with each additional gram of weight reduction costing disproportionately more. The minimalist must decide where their personal point of diminishing returns lies.

Value Assessment Framework

A $120 titanium canister stove that saves 0.8 ounces over a $40 model represents $100 per ounce saved. For the weekend warrior, this is absurd. For the thru-hiker counting every gram over 2,000 miles, it’s one of the most cost-effective weight reductions available when compared to swapping a backpack or shelter.

Field Maintenance and Repairability

The beauty of minimalist stoves lies in their repairability. A canister stove has exactly two moving parts: the valve and the flame adjuster. Alcohol stoves have none. This simplicity means field repairs are often possible with basic tools, while complex stoves would be hopeless.

Essential Repair Kit

The ultralight maintenance kit weighs under 0.2 ounces: a few O-rings, a titanium pick for clearing jets, and a small square of fine-grit sandpaper. This micro-kit can address 95% of field issues, embodying the self-sufficient ethos that drives minimalist backpacking culture.

Frequently Asked Questions

Can a stove under 3 ounces actually boil water efficiently in real conditions?

Absolutely, but efficiency depends more on your system than the stove alone. With proper wind protection and a well-matched pot, most sub-3oz stoves can boil a pint of water in 4-6 minutes using 7-10 grams of fuel. The key is practicing your setup and understanding that “efficiency” in ultralight terms means adequate performance with minimal weight, not restaurant-speed service.

What’s the most reliable fuel type for extended ultralight trips?

For trips over a week without resupply, alcohol offers the best reliability-to-weight ratio. Fuel is readily available in trail towns (as denatured alcohol or HEET), and stove simplicity means virtually nothing can break. Canister stoves edge out alcohol for shorter trips or when precise temperature control matters, but they create dependency on specific fuel canisters that may be unavailable in remote areas.

How do I manage wind without carrying a separate windscreen?

Site selection is your primary tool—cook in sheltered areas, behind rocks, or using your pack as a barrier. Many ultralight stoves can be used inside the pot’s stuff sack during setup for additional protection. Some minimalist hikers create natural windbreaks from stones or snow, while others reppose their sleeping pad as a temporary shield during the brief cooking period.

Are titanium stoves really worth triple the cost of aluminum alternatives?

For most users, yes— but not for the weight savings alone. Titanium’s real advantage is durability and heat resistance. Aluminum stoves soften over time with repeated heating cycles, eventually deforming under a pot’s weight. Titanium maintains its structure indefinitely. If you’re planning 50+ nights in the field annually, titanium’s longevity makes it more economical long-term.

Can these stoves do more than just boil water for freezer-bag meals?

Skillful minimalists can absolutely simmer, sauté, and even bake on sub-3oz stoves, but it requires technique. With alcohol stoves, you learn to partially cover the burner to reduce oxygen and lower flame intensity. Canister stoves demand precise valve control and constant pot movement. The limitation isn’t the stove’s capability—it’s the user’s willingness to develop the necessary finesse.

How do fire bans affect stove choice for ultralight hikers?

Most fire bans specifically prohibit wood-burning stoves but allow contained flame devices like canister and alcohol stoves. However, some extreme fire restrictions ban any open flame, including alcohol stoves without shut-off valves. The savvy minimalist carries a printout of current regulations and chooses a canister stove (with instant-off capability) for trips through fire-prone areas during dry seasons.

What’s the realistic lifespan of a sub-3oz stove with regular use?

A well-cared-for titanium stove should last 5-10 years of heavy use. The valve mechanism on canister stoves typically fails first, usually after 300-500 canister attachments. Alcohol stoves last indefinitely unless physically crushed. The key is cleaning threads regularly, storing the stove dry, and avoiding the temptation to overtighten connections, which stresses precisely-machined components.

Is it safe to use these tiny stoves inside a tent vestibule?

Never inside the tent itself, but in a well-ventilated vestibule with the door fully open, the risk is manageable for experienced users. The primary dangers are carbon monoxide (from incomplete combustion) and fire. Always use a carbon monoxide detector on winter trips, never cook in an enclosed space, and keep a water bottle within arm’s reach for emergencies. The vestibule should be considered a sheltered outdoor space, not indoor shelter.

How steep is the learning curve for switching from canister to alcohol stoves?

Expect a 3-5 trip adjustment period. You’ll need to learn fuel measurement, priming techniques, and wind management from scratch. Your first few boils will likely be frustratingly slow or fuel-wasteful. But by trip five, the process becomes automatic, and you’ll appreciate the silence, simplicity, and fuel flexibility that alcohol offers. Many minimalists find the ritual itself becomes part of their trail meditation.

How do I calculate precise fuel needs for a 7-day trip without resupply?

Start with baseline measurements: boil a pint at home using your exact pot and windscreen setup, measuring fuel consumed. Multiply by your daily hot meals and drinks, then add 25% for wind and cold water. For most ultralight systems, this works out to 0.75-1 ounce of alcohol or 5-7 grams of canister fuel per day. Always carry a 20% safety margin, and remember that experienced minimalists tend to use less fuel as their technique improves, so your calculations should become more conservative over time.
